
Meet Mr. Luis Estrella. Mr. Estrella has been a part of the Banning Unified School District family since 2003. In his 20 years at Banning USD, he has taught at various campuses and now calls Central ES home. In his free time, Mr. Estrella loves to work in his garden tending to his roses and cherry trees. His favorite pastimes are to enjoy his morning coffee in his backyard, relax, watch and listen to the waves on the beach with a good book whenever he and his family are on vacation. He loves to follow his beloved Dodgers and his favorite sport is Boxing. #BanningUSD

Meet Dr. Veronica Pendleton, Director of Educational Services. English is her second language, and she was a long-term English learner throughout school. She was also a teen parent at the age of 16 and still graduated high school. Dr. Pendleton is the proud mother of 5 adult children and grandmother to seven amazing children. She has been married for 20 years and lives on a vineyard with a pack of local coyotes. She LOVES to spend time with the people that she loves, they energize her and fill her with joy. Dr. Pendleton has been an educator for 26 years. Dr. Pendleton says she is incredibly passionate about working and serving in the Banning USD because it is a community with a rich and profound history. The residents, dedicated employees, and students all share a unique bond that spans generations of families within this close-knit community. Their shared commitment to providing children with a high-quality education is truly inspiring. #BanningUSD
